Using National Juvenile Corrections Data Files: 1997–2006
June 1–3, 2009
National Archive of Criminal Justice Data, University of Michigan
Sponsored by the Office of Juvenile Justice and Delinquency Prevention (OJJDP)

What topics are covered? Trends in juvenile corrections populations at the national and state levels, the
residential facilities that hold them, the variations in practices in place, and the services provided to young persons
in custody.
Who should attend this workshop? State and local juvenile justice researchers, academic researchers, and policy
makers at the local, state, and federal levels. Jurisdictional teams are welcome.
Purpose: This inaugural workshop will make a wealth of national data from OJJDP’s data collections from
1997–2006 available to researchers and practitioners along with the tools necessary to understand and use the data
appropriately.
Objectives: Participants in this 3-day workshop will learn to analyze multi-year national data files on juvenile
corrections using the Secure Survey Documentation and Analysis (Secure SDA), a powerful online data analysis
tool that enables descriptive to multivariate analysis of data from different surveys and over time.
Datasets:
• Census of Juveniles in Residential Placement (CJRP) 1997, 1999, 2001, 2003, 2006
• Juvenile Residential Placement Facilities Census (JRFC) 1998, 2000, 2002, 2004, 2006
